For the 2026 school year, there are 2 public schools serving 529 students in 41129, KY.
The top-ranked public schools in 41129, KY are Ponderosa Elementary School and Catlettsburg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public schools in zipcode 41129 have an average math proficiency score of 49% (versus the Kentucky public school average of 39%), and reading proficiency score of 52% (versus the 45% statewide average). Schools in 41129, KY have an average ranking of 9/10, which is in the top 20% of Kentucky public schools.
Minority enrollment is 8%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Kentucky public school average of 28% (majority Black and Hispanic).
